Mission College Presents:
The Summer Concert Series

Get ready for a season of sensational live music as Mission College proudly presents its annual Summer Concert Series! As we celebrate our 50th anniversary all summer long in 2025, the community is invited to gather in the Central Plaza for an unforgettable lineup of free, outdoor performances featuring a mix of jazz, salsa, blues, and more.

Concert Schedule and Band Details

  • Tony Lindsay

    Tony Lindsay

    June 4 (Jazz and R&B)

    Grammy-winning vocalist Tony Lindsay, best known for his work as the lead singer of Santana, brings his signature smooth vocals and soulful jazz and R&B sound to the stage. His dynamic performances captivate audiences with rich melodies and timeless grooves.

  • Edgardo & Candela (Salsa)

    Edgardo & Candela

    June 18 (Salsa)

    Edgardo & Candela is a high-energy salsa band that delivers infectious Latin rhythms and electrifying performances. Led by renowned percussionist Edgardo Cambón, the group blends traditional and contemporary salsa, keeping audiences dancing all night long.

  • Orquesta Dharma

    Orquesta Dharma

    July 16 (Latin Jazz & Salsa)

    A fusion of Latin jazz and salsa, Orquesta Dharma delivers vibrant, horn-driven arrangements with dynamic rhythms. Their passionate performances celebrate the rich traditions of Afro-Cuban and Latin American music, bringing energy and soul to every show.

  • Iko Ya Ya

    Iko Ya Ya

    July 30 (R&B, Blues, Zydeco & Cajun)

    Bringing the spirit of New Orleans to the West Coast, Iko Ya Ya blends R&B, blues, zydeco, and Cajun music for a lively, foot-stomping good time. Their infectious energy and mix of classic and modern sounds make for an unforgettable experience.

  • Lavay Smith and The Red Hot Skillet Lickers

    Lavay Smith & The Red Hot Skillet Lickers

    August 6 (Swing, Blues & R&B)

    One of the top swing and blues bands in the nation, Lavay Smith & The Red Hot Skillet Lickers channel the golden era of jazz and R&B with vintage flair. Featuring sultry vocals and a powerhouse band, their performances transport audiences to the smoky jazz clubs of the past.
